What your working day will look like:
- Participating in all branch processes
- Building positive relationships with customers, patients, and healthcare professionals
- Assisting in the delivery of pharmacy services
- Serving as an ambassador for Rowlands Pharmacy, representing the company and interacting with the community on a daily basis
To be considered for this role, you must have:
- An NVQ2 in Pharmacy Services or an accredited equivalent course
- A Medicine Counter Assistant (MCA) qualification
Evidence of qualifications held will be required for the successful candidate. Additionally, we are looking for candidates with experience working in a customer-focused environment, a strong understanding of confidentiality, and the ability to handle medications accurately.
